Saint-Cloud, located just west of Paris, offers a range of activities and attractions that reflect its historical and cultural significance. Exploring the Parc de Saint-Cloud is a must, as this expansive park boasts beautiful gardens, fountains, and panoramic views of the Seine River and the Paris skyline. The park is an ideal spot for a leisurely walk or a picnic, providing a peaceful escape from the city's hustle.
Another notable site is the Château de Saint-Cloud, which was once a royal residence. Although much of the original structure was destroyed, visitors can still appreciate the remaining architecture and the historical context of the site. The surrounding gardens are well-maintained and provide a serene environment for relaxation and contemplation.
